Position Purpose
Dartmouth will often bundle a group of capital projects with a common objective into a discrete program. The Program Manager has supporting responsibility for the execution and management of specific capital program(s). These programs will be defined by the Senior Director, Project Management Services, as priorities are defined by senior College leadership. The position is responsible for the successful delivery of capital projects assigned to themselves, direct reports, and/or external project managers, including planning, estimating, budget control, permitting, construction, scheduling, reporting, and problem solving. Dartmouth's Campus Services is responsible for planning, design, construction and operation of Dartmouth's buildings, campus landscape and infrastructure. Dartmouth's facilities include over 5 million square feet of space in 165 buildings. These facilities serve over 5,600 students and 5,000 faculty and staff in a variety of academic, research, administrative, athletic, and residential spaces. Description Program Management
- Recommends priority of renovation and renewal projects within the program in collaboration with the other Directors and Managers within Campus Services. Develops proposals to substantiate program priorities and resulting impact on Dartmouth's buildings, infrastructure, and capital/operating budgets.
- Collaborates with the Assistant Director for Renovation & Renewal to develop and apply project delivery methods to assure best value results. Participates as a senior member of team of professionals in project planning and programming.
- Serves as main Dartmouth point of contact for external owner's project management (OPM) teams. Ensures OPM follows appropriate College policies and procedures - particularly related to communication, procurement, and internal approvals.
- Establishes estimating and cost control procedures to ensure efficient utilization of institutional funds.
- Evaluates and tracks performance parameters including program-level budgets, schedules, and approvals. Supports reporting to administrative, faculty and trustee committees on program status and all associated facilities design and construction projects.
- Works with considerable latitude and independence under the general guidance of the Assistant Director of Renovation & Renewal. Takes initiative in anticipating technical issues and problems that will confront the College.
50
Description Project Management
- For assigned projects, leads the capital project delivery process through the study, design, construction and close-out phases of new construction and renovation projects. Facilitates communication throughout project, particularly during transition from one phase to the next. Develops and maintains project schedules and budgets from planning through project closeout.
- Keeps stakeholders well-informed of project status through regular team meetings and presentation of capital project reports. Takes leadership role to resolve areas of disagreement between project stakeholders. Collaborates and coordinates activities with the Directors and Managers within Campus Services including project scope, impact on operations, and technical specifications.
- Manages the project team composed of consultants, contractors, and College stakeholders to develop and review construction documents consistent with the approved project scope and budget.
- Manages the bidding and construction process to ensure timely delivery of facility. Arranges and monitors the timely and orderly Project Closeout activities.
- Coordinates submissions to Jurisdictional Authorities for permitting and ensures compliance with appropriate regulations.
- Responsible for project quality control and cost control. Provides budget updates, reviews proposed change orders and discusses project issues with the AD as needed. Coordinates the value engineering process.
- Actively applies sustainability and energy efficiency principles.
